Mechanical Jobs in Cullman, Alabama

Overview

Embarking on a career in the mechanical trade in Cullman, AL typically begins with an apprenticeship that blends hands-on experience with classroom learning, enabling individuals to earn while they learn. Apprenticeships generally last three to four years, requiring extensive training under licensed professionals. According to the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ics, there are approximately 1,000 mechanical trade professionals in Alabama, with wages ranging from $578.67 to $1,385.67 per week. The job growth for mechanical trades is projected to be 11%, much faster than the average for all occupations.
